Bill Curry Rejuvenated at Georgia State

Filed under: Coaching
ATLANTA -- Bill Curry, Jr. strolled the sideline in the Georgia Dome examining his father's ambitious endeavor, which was to create a football program from scratch at Georgia State University. An executive in Charlotte who fancies himself as a football swami, Bill, Jr. walked and examined and then wandered over to his father during pregame warm-ups.

Bill, Jr. did not try and contain his wonder.

"I'm shocked," he said to his father, the Georgia State coach. "You actually look like a football team."

He started calling out numbers on jerseys to Bill, Sr.

Can that guy play?

"Yes, he can," Bill, Sr. said.
